The video tutorial explores the concept of memory, breaking it down into sensory, long-term, and working memory. It highlights the limitations and characteristics of each type, emphasizing the importance of attention and chunking in memory retention. The tutorial also discusses the implications of these memory types on learning and how they can be leveraged to improve study skills.
